sock=socket.socket(socket.AF_INET,socket.SOCK_STREAM)try:sock.bind(('localhost',8080))exceptOSErrorase:print(f"绑定失败:{e}") 1. 2. 3. 4. 5. 6. 7. 性能调优 对于网络应用而言,优化bind函数的使用至关重要。针对bind操作的优化策略涵盖了多个方面,比如
1.函数定义:bind()函数用于将一个socket绑定到一个地址和端口上。函数的定义如下:```python socket.bind(address)```2.参数说明:bind()函数接收一个参数address,表示要绑定的地址和端口。address可以是一个元组,包含了IP地址和端口号。```python address = (hostname, port)```其中,hostname是一个字符串...
34 # 1、如果爬取得数据量比较大时,如果没有闭包机制,每次爬取得内容都会占用内存,但是有闭包的机制,第一次爬取时已经读到内存,以后爬取时都是从内存的读到的数据,并不是从url在爬取一次 35 #2、装饰器,装饰器的基本原理就是通过闭包实现的不用担心爬取的内容会一直占用内存,python内部有垃圾回收机制,如果...
bind()函数是Python Socket编程中的一个重要函数,用于将套接字与特定的网络地址绑定起来。它的主要用途是在服务器端指定IP地址和端口号,以便监听和接受连接请求。bind()函数的工作方式是将套接字与指定的地址绑定起来,使其能够在该地址上监听连接请求或接收数据。 在使用bind()函数时,需要注意地址的格式和合法性,...
python的bind函数 #-*- coding:utf-8 -*-classFunctor(object):def__init__(self, func, index=0, *args, **kwargs): self._Func=func self._Index=index self._Args=args self._Kwargs=kwargsdef__call__(self, *args, **kwargs):
在Python中,panel.Bind函数通常与GUI(图形用户界面)编程相关,特别是在使用wxPython库时。以下是关于panel.Bind函数的详细解析: 1. panel.Bind函数的作用和用途 panel.Bind函数用于将特定事件与事件处理函数绑定。当指定的事件发生时,wxPython会自动调用相应的事件处理函数。这在创建交互式GUI应用程序时非常有用,因为它允...
```python importsocket #创建一个Socket对象 s=socket.socket(socket.AF_INET,socket.SOCK_STREAM) #绑定Socket到本地地址和端口上 s.bind(('localhost',8080)) #开始监听连接请求 s.listen(5) ``` 在上面的代码中,我们创建了一个Socket对象,并使用bind函数将其绑定到本地地址和端口上(在本例中是"localhos...
:这样写能正确关联我想把参数传递到方法里面去用,于是改如下:entry=Entry(app,font=ft2)entry.bind(...
使用bind可以将函数从类成员变量中提取出来 这里以结构体的类成员函数作为说明 #include<iostream>#include<functional>usingnamespacestd;usingnamespacestd::placeholders;structMyStruct{voidadd1(inta) { cout<< a <<endl; }voidadd2(inta,intb) {
在Python中,bin()函数用于将整数转换为二进制字符串。其语法如下: bin(x) 其中x是要转换的整数。bin()函数返回一个名为“0b”的函数初始二进制字符串表示x的值。例如: num = 10 binary_num = bin(数字) print(binary _ num)#输出:0b1010